Odessa Port Plant (OPP) Ukraine Odessa Port Plant is one of the key producers of ammonia, urea and of some other chemical by-products on the territory of Ukraine. The Plant also does the transshipping of products made by other enterprises from Ukraine and Russia, such as: ammonia, urea, methanol, and UAN. These products come to OPP transshipment terminals by railway or through a 2471 km long pipeline Togliatti-Gorlovka-Odessa.
